Abstract

Official abstract text for this publication.

An automatic code generator that may be located at a server may generate code to handle crowdsourced data. The crowdsourced data may come from members of the public using automatic data collection technology on mobile devices, in one embodiment.

First claim

Opening claim text (preview).

What is claimed is: 1. A method comprising: providing an interface to enable providers of crowdsourced data to specify a function for a source code application to handle crowdsourced data from an automatic data collection device; and automatically generating using an automatic code generator, the source code for the source code application in response to the crowdsourced data, said source code to implement, said function. 2. The method of claim 1 including automatically collecting position information data. 3. The method of claim 1 including automatically collecting photographic information. 4. The method of claim 1 including controlling access to the generated code. 5. The method of claim 1 including collecting information from mobile computers. 6. The method of claim 1 including automatically generating code at a server. 7. The method of claim 6 including automatically collecting crowdsourced data from mobile devices. 8. A non-transitory computer readable medium storing instructions to enable a computer to: providing an interface to enable providers of crowdsourced data to specify a function for a source code application to handle crowdsourced data from an automatic data collection device; and automatically generate using an automatic code generator, the source code for the source code application in response to the crowdsourced, said source code to implement, said function. 9. The medium of claim 8 further storing instructions to automatically collect position information data. 10. The medium of claim 8 further storing instructions to automatically collect photographic information. 11. The medium of claim 8 further storing instructions to control access to the generated code. 12. The medium of claim 8 further storing instructions to collect information from mobile computers. 13. The medium of claim 8 further storing instructions to generate code at a server. 14. The medium of claim 13 further storing instructions to collect crowdsourced data from mobile devices. 15. An apparatus comprising: a hardware processor to provide an interface to enable providers of crowdsourced data to specify a function for a source code application to handle crowdsourced data from an automatic data collection device and automatically generate using an automatic code generator, the source code for the source code application in response to the crowdsourced data, said source code to implement said function; and a storage coupled to said processor. 16. The apparatus of claim 15 , said hardware processor to automatically collect position information data. 17. The apparatus of claim 15 , said hardware processor to automatically collect photographic information. 18. The apparatus of claim 15 , said hardware processor to control access to the generated code. 19. The apparatus of claim 15 , said hardware processor to collect information from mobile computers. 20. The apparatus of claim 15 wherein said hardware apparatus includes a server. 21. The apparatus of claim 20 , said hardware processor to automatically collect crowdsourced data from mobile devices.
